One in 10 children becomes obese or overweight in primary school years

One in 10 children starting primary school in England at a healthy weight is obese or overweight on leaving, figures from Cancer Research UK have shown.1
The analysis showed that an average of 57 100 (10%) of children leaving primary school in England each year from 2012-13 to 2014-15 were overweight or obese by body mass index (BMI), having started school at a healthy BMI from 2006-07 to 2008-09.
